A Court of Appeal, sitting in Makurdi, Benue State, has nullified the election of former senate president, David Mark.
The
court faulted the decision of the Independent National Electoral Commission to
declare Mr. Mark, the candidate of the Peoples Democratic Party, winner of the
March 28 senatorial election in Benue south.
A
rerun of the poll must be conducted within 90 days, the court ruled.
Mr.
Mark’s purported victory was challenged by the candidate of the All
Progressives Congress, Donald Onjeh.
Among
other claims, the APC candidate said INEC declared the result of the election
while collation was ongoing.
That
claim was earlier dismissed by the Benue State National and State Assembly
Election Petitions Tribunal, which upheld Mr. Mark’s victory.
The
appeal court set aside that decision.
